What happens to you when you eat snow
“A small amount is non-toxic.” (Think: taking a bite out of a snowball.) But “it’s not great to make a meal out of it,” Dr.
Calello says.
Depending on what’s in your snow, you could end up with an upset stomach, vomiting, diarrhea, or possibly even an infection if you eat too much..

Is it safe to eat snow from outside
The Good News. On a positive note: The amount of contaminants that snow gathers is so small that eating a handful of the fluffy white stuff is not harmful. … But there’s no need to worry if your little one brings you a bowl of freshly fallen snow and asks to have a bite.

What happens if you boil snow
Melting the snow– As a rule of the thumb, do not boil snow directly into a cooking pot. Not only does this burn the pot, the water used to melt the snow may evaporate. Instead, put a little water in the boiling pot over the fire.
Is it safe to eat snow ice
And “never eat snow that’s been plowed,” advises Mark Williams of the Institute of Arctic and Alpine Research at the University of Colorado. It’s likely to contain sand and chemicals such as magnesium chloride. “All this gets incorporated into the plowed snow and is bad for you.”

Can you get sick from eating snow
Most people have good immunity and don’t eat enough snow to affect them. Others may get an upset stomach and experience some diarrhea. Someone who eats a large amount of snow, or snow with a large amount of contamination, could be very sick, Johnson said.

How do you boil snow safely
Purification Methods: Boiling – If your heat source is a stove or fire, then your easiest method of purification is probably going to be boiling. Simply bring your water to a frothy, rolling boil and let it continue boiling for at least 5 minutes. Then remove from heat and let it cool.
Why is the snow dirty
Nolin, who studies snow and ice in the climate system, says most snow is just as clean as any drinking water. … That’s because as snow sits around, it goes through a process called dry deposition, in which dust and dirt particles stick to the snow.

Can you boil snow and drink it
Freshly melted snow is generally considered to be safe to drink without further treatment, however it should not be assumed that because water is frozen that it is safe to drink. Exercise the same caution for melted Ice as you would for standing water, and if in doubt boil the water for 10 minutes.
